Lois Thomson
Lois arrived in New York on 13 June 1862 via the ship Manchester, traveling with her parents, John and Jane Thomson, and her brother James. She is listed on the roster of the James Brown company as part of "and family" with her father. She died en route. The Deseret News article states "There was but one death by the way--a Mrs. Thompson, from England." It is likely that this refers to Lois Thomson, who was unmarried.
The family sailed to America in 1862 on the ship Manchester.
